' BTN_TEST2.BS2 ' Written by Timothy Gilmore ' January 18, 2009 ' {$STAMP BS2} ' {$PBASIC 2.5} ' Connect an active-low circuit to pin P0 of the BS2. When you press the ' button, the servos will cause movement, then DELAy approximately one second ' (200 x 5 ms PAUSE) before auto-repeating at a rate of approximately 100 ms (5 x 20 ms). Btn0 PIN 0 ' ------------------------------------------------------------------------------ ' Constants ' ------------------------------------------------------------------------------ ' ------------------------------------------------------------------------------ ' Variables ' ------------------------------------------------------------------------------ btnWrk0 VAR Byte cnt VAR Byte ' ------------------------------------------------------------------------------ ' Initialization ' ------------------------------------------------------------------------------ Initialize: ' ------------------------------------------------------------------------------ ' Program Code ' ------------------------------------------------------------------------------ Main: 'Button is not pushed here PULSOUT 12, 1000 PULSOUT 13, 500 ' Try changing the Delay value (255) in BUTTON to see the effect of ' its modes: 0 = no delay; 1-254 = varying delays before auto-repeat; ' 255 = no auto-repeat (only one action per button press) PAUSE 5 BUTTON Btn0, 0, 200, 20, btnWrk0, 0, No_Press 'Button is pushed so do something here FOR cnt=1 TO 50 PULSOUT 12, 500 PULSOUT 13, 1000 PULSOUT 12, 1000 PULSOUT 13, 1000 NEXT No_Press: GOTO Main 'Repeat process▔▔▔▔▔▔▔▔▔▔▔▔▔▔▔▔▔▔▔▔▔▔▔▔
